Essential Traits to Verify Before Purchase

When selecting your new queen, ensure she exhibits vital characteristics that promote hive health and productivity. Look for queens that have been mated properly, as this ensures genetic diversity and vitality among worker bees. Confirm the queen shows signs Mated queen bees of vigorous egg-laying and a calm temperament, which can significantly ease hive management. Additionally, examine the queen’s physical appearance—healthy queens typically have a robust thorax and a well-formed abdomen, indicating strong reproductive potential.

Checklist for Introducing a New Queen to Your Hive

Introducing a new queen requires careful steps to increase acceptance and reduce stress within the colony. Start by removing any existing queen to avoid conflicts. Use a queen cage for gradual introduction, allowing worker bees to acclimate to her pheromones. Monitor the Russian bees hive regularly for signs of acceptance such as feeding and grooming behaviors directed toward the new queen. Keep environmental conditions stable with moderate temperature and low disturbance during this integration period to foster a smooth transition.

Key Considerations for Maintaining Queen Quality

Proper maintenance of the queen’s health is crucial for the hive’s success. Ensure she has access to abundant nutrition through diverse pollen sources and quality nectar, supporting sustained egg-laying. Regularly check for signs of disease or parasites that could impair her function, and take swift steps to protect the colony if problems arise.
